New Study Explores 40 Years of Avian Collision Risk Modelling

A recent paper in Environmental Impact Assessment Review, co-authored by Dr Elizabeth Masden, critically examines 40 years of avian collision risk models (CRMs) within the Environmental Impact Assessment (EIA) process for wind farms. Reviewing 52 models, the study highlights increasing complexity over time, yet notes limited application of advances in regulatory practices. It recommends validating models using post-construction monitoring data and improving stakeholder collaboration to enhance confidence in CRM approaches.
